Magy Seif El-Nasr

Magy Seif El-Nasr is a professor and Chair of the Department of Computational Media at the University of California, Santa Cruz. In 2024, she was appointed an endowed chair position as the UC Presidential Chair. She directs the Games User interaction and Intelligence Lab at UCSC. In January 2026, she was appointed the editor in chief of the IEEE Transactions on Games, one of the premier journals in the field of technical games research. She is recognized for her work in serious games, game design, game analytics, affective computing, and artificial intelligence.

Early life and education
Seif El-Nasr earned a Bachelor of Science in Computer science from the American University in Cairo in 1995. Academic career
Before joining UCSC, she held several academic positions, including professor and vice chair of the Serious Games Program at UCSC from 2020 to 2022, full professor at Northeastern University in 2020, and associate professor (tenured) at Northeastern University from 2011 to 2020. She was appointed assistant professor at Simon Fraser University from 2007 to 2011 and Pennsylvania State University from 2003 to 2007. Seif El-Nasr has also held teaching positions at Northwestern University and Texas A&M University. Research
Seif El-Nasr's research focuses on serious games, game design, game data science, user experience, affective computing, and the application of artificial intelligence in interactive systems. She has published extensively in these fields, with over 130 peer-reviewed conference papers and 38 journal articles.
